The M 1000 RR is the first full-fledged M motorcycle from BMW and the flagship of the entire motorcycle lineup. With 218 PS from the 999 ccm four-cylinder, carbon forged wheels, Brembo Monoblock Nickel Stylema brakes, and homologated for the World Superbike Championship (WSBK), it sets new benchmarks. Every detail reflects its motorsport pedigree: titanium connecting rods, aerodynamic winglets, Öhlins suspension, and seven-stage traction control with Slide Control. The engine revs up to 15,100 rpm and reaches a top speed of 306 km/h. The optional M Competition packages add race-spec paintwork, an extended tail section, and GPS-based lap triggers. The most uncompromising choice for WSBK ambitions and track day enthusiasts.

Specifications

EngineLiquid-cooled 4-cylinder inline engine with ShiftCam
Displacement999 cm³
Power218 PS (160 kW) at 14,500 rpm
Torque113 Nm at 11,000 rpm
Transmission6-speed with Shift Assistant Pro
FrameAlu bridge tube frame
SuspensionÖhlins fork and shock absorber
WheelsCarbon forged wheels
BrakesBrembo Stylema Nickel-Coating
Seat Height832 mm
Fuel tank capacity16,5 l
Curb weight192 kg
Top speed306 km/h
ColorsLightwhite / Motorsport, Blackstorm metallic
Price from33.395 EUR
